Saint Martin Church is a parish Catholic church located in Mareil-en-France, France. From the outside, only the bell tower and the western facade of the mid-19th century are visible from the public domain, and without interest. All the rest of the church was built during a single construction campaign at the beginning of the last quarter of the sixteenth century, and seduced by the homogeneity and quality of its Renaissance architecture.

The order and monumental sculpture bear the artistic signature of master mason Nicolas de Saint-Michel, of Luzarches, and show a striking resemblance to Saint Martin's church in Attainville. Like all other churches built by the same architect, the vaulting of warheads and the general arrangement are inherited from Gothic architecture, but if one looks only at the supports, one might believe oneself in an ancient building. What distinguishes the church of Mareil-en-France is its exceptional plan with complete walk-through, without radiant chapels, but with a thread of shallow chapels all around the church, thanks to foothills facing inward.
